What is a COB LED Par Light?

COB stands for Chip on Board, which refers to the way the LED chips are packaged in these lights Unlike traditional LEDs that use individual chips mounted on a circuit board, COB LEDs feature multiple chips bonded directly to a substrate This design results in a higher light output and better thermal management, making COB LED par lights more efficient and reliable than their counterparts.

A par light, on the other hand, is a type of lighting fixture that produces a concentrated beam of light It is widely used in stage performances, concerts, clubs, and architectural lighting to highlight specific areas or objects When combined with COB LED technology, par lights offer a powerful and versatile lighting solution that can create stunning visual effects.

How Do COB LED Par Lights Work?

COB LED par lights work by producing light through the process of electroluminescence When an electric current passes through the semiconductor material in the LED chip, it excites the electrons, causing them to emit photons The color of the light produced depends on the bandgap of the semiconductor material, with different materials emitting different colors.

In a COB LED par light, multiple LED chips are arranged closely together to create a single, high-intensity light source This design allows the light to be evenly distributed and provides a more uniform beam compared to traditional par lights Additionally, the high thermal conductivity of the substrate helps to dissipate heat efficiently, preventing overheating and prolonging the lifespan of the LEDs.

Why Choose COB LED Par Lights?

One of the main advantages of these lights is their high energy efficiency COB LEDs consume less power than traditional lighting sources, such as incandescent or fluorescent bulbs, while producing the same amount of light This not only helps to reduce energy costs but also lowers the carbon footprint of the lighting setup.

Another benefit of COB LED par lights is their superior color mixing capabilities Thanks to the close arrangement of the LED chips, these lights can create a wide range of colors by blending the light emitted by different chips This makes them ideal for creating dynamic lighting effects and mood lighting for various events and settings.

Additionally, COB LED par lights offer excellent control over the light output Many models come with built-in dimming and color mixing features, allowing users to adjust the brightness and color temperature of the light as needed Some lights also include wireless connectivity options, such as DMX and Bluetooth, for remote control and synchronization with other lighting fixtures.
